When a website receives an excessive number of requests within a short period, it triggers a rate limit error. This is known as “too many requests” or “429 Too Many Requests.” It’s a common issue experienced by websites that attract high traffic volumes.
The primary reason for this phenomenon is the server’s capacity to handle the influx of requests. When too many users attempt to access a website simultaneously, it puts a strain on the server’s resources, leading to errors.
To mitigate this issue, most web servers have built-in rate limiting mechanisms that restrict the number of requests allowed within a specific timeframe. These limits can vary depending on the server configuration and traffic patterns.
When you encounter the “429 Too Many Requests” error, it usually means that your IP address has exceeded the maximum allowed requests for a particular time frame. To resolve this issue, try the following:
* Wait for a specified amount of time before making further requests.
* Check if there are any maintenance or technical issues affecting the website.
* Use tools like caching and content delivery networks (CDNs) to reduce the load on the server.
By understanding the causes of “too many requests” errors and implementing strategies to manage traffic, you can help ensure a smoother online experience for yourself and others.
Source: https://www.cbssports.com/college-football/news/michigan-sign-stealing-penalties-jim-harbaugh-10-year-show-cause-hefty-fines-among-ncaa-punishments